The Sovereign 400 was designed by Rob Humphries as a fast and powerful offshore cruiser, suitable for blue water sailing with minimal crew. She is heavily constructed, and has a full lead keel for maximum performance. There is accommodation for seven persons on board in an attractive hand-finished interior with two heads/shower compartments, and she is equipped to a high standard.
Built by Sovereign Yachts, Southampton UK in 2007 to designs by Rob Humphries
CE directive 94/25/CE (Category A - 'Ocean') for recreational craft.
Construction:
GRP and Balsa sandwich construction.
The hull incorporates 2 transverse longitudinal stringers with 9 ring frames to provide added hull strength and stiffness.
Hull to deck joint with polyurethane sealant and mechanical fasteners.
Bulkheads bonded to hull and deck.
The keel is lead antimony.
Standard draft 1.95m/6'4"
Spade rudder with solid stainless stock and self-aligning bearings. Top bearing serviced 2014
Lewmar Whitlock precision rack and pinion steering system. Full service 2014
